CBC Holding Company is a small regional bank holding company based in the United States. It owns a community bank that offers everyday banking services like checking and savings accounts, loans, and mortgages. Its main customers are individuals and small businesses in the local communities it serves.

The company makes money primarily through net interest income — it takes in deposits and lends that money out at higher interest rates, keeping the difference as profit. With a market cap near zero, this is a very small institution with limited geographic reach and little public information available. Small community banks like this face real pressure from larger national banks and fintech apps that can offer lower fees and more convenient digital tools, which remains a key long-term risk to its ability to hold onto customers.
